Cuadro combinado,

Hola Sofocles, Necesito sincronizar un cuadro combinado de un subformulario con otro cuadro combinado del formulario principal. He visto algo similar en todoaccess, pero es todo para el mismo formulario. Si hay que escribir código te agradecería que me mandaras algún ejemplo. Te agradezco de antemano tu ayuda.

1 Respuesta

Respuesta
1
Debes escribir algo de código en el evento después de actualizar del cuadro combinado del formulario principal, más o menos así:
Sub Cuadro_AfterUpdate()
Dim sql as string
sql="SELECT * FROM [NombreTabla]"
sql=sql & " WHERE [NombreTabla].Campo=" & Criterios
De esta forma creamos la consulta que alimentara el cuadro combinado del subformulario.
Ahora seteamos el subformulario de la siguiente forma:
DIM F AS FORM, SF AS FORM
SET F=FORMS![NombreFormPrincipal]
SET SF=F![NombreSubFormulario]
Ahora enviamos el valor de la consulta al cuadro combinado del subformulario:
SF.Recordsource=sql
Y voila, ya lo tienes sincronizado.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as